open Ast;;
open InterpreterStdlib;;
let default_env: environment = [Hashtbl.create 1024];;
let add_builtin s f =
env_set_global default_env s (LBuiltinFunction (s, f))
let add_special s f =
env_set_global default_env s (LBuiltinSpecial (s, f))
let make_env () = [Hashtbl.copy (List.hd default_env)]
(* the type annotations are unnecessary, but help constrain us from a
potentially more general function here *)
let rec eval_sym (env: environment) (s: string) =
match env with
| [] -> raise (Invalid_argument (Printf.sprintf "eval_sym: symbol %s has no value in current scope" s))
| e :: rest ->
match Hashtbl.find_opt e s with
| None -> eval_sym rest s
| Some v -> v
let rec eval_one env = function
| LSymbol s -> eval_sym env s
| LCons (func, args) -> eval_call env (eval_one env func) args
| LQuoted v -> v
| v -> v (* All other forms are self-evaluating *)
(* Evaluate a list of values, without evaluating the resulting
function or macro call. Since macros and functions inherently
look similar, they share a lot of code, which is extracted here *)
and eval_list env l =
match l with
| LNil -> LNil
| LCons (a, b) -> LCons (eval_one env a, eval_list env b)
| _ -> raise (Invalid_argument "eval_list: cannot process non-list")
and eval_body env body =
match body with
| LNil -> LNil
| LCons (form, LNil) -> eval_one env form
| LCons (form, next) -> ignore (eval_one env form); eval_body env next
| _ -> LNil
and err s = raise (Invalid_argument s)
and bind_args env = function
| LNil -> (function
| LNil -> ()
| _ -> err "cannot bind arguments")
| LSymbol s ->
(function
| v -> env_set_local env s v; ())
| LCons (LSymbol hl, tl) -> (function
| LCons (ha, ta) ->
env_set_local env hl ha;
bind_args env tl ta;
| _ -> err "cannot bind arguments")
| _ -> fun _ -> err "bind_args"
and eval_apply args = function
| LLambda (e, l, b)
| LFunction (_, e, l, b) ->
let lexical_env = env_new_lexical e in
bind_args lexical_env l args;
eval_body lexical_env b
| LUnnamedMacro (e, l, b)
| LMacro (_, e, l, b) ->
let lexical_env = env_new_lexical e in
bind_args lexical_env l args;
eval_body lexical_env b
| v ->
err ("Non-macro non-function value passed to eval_apply "
^ dbg_print_one v); LNil
and eval_call env func args =
match func with
| LBuiltinSpecial (_, f) -> f env args
| LBuiltinFunction (_, f) -> f env (eval_list env args)
(* The function calls don't happen in the calling environment,
so it makes no sense to pass env to a call. *)
| LLambda _
| LFunction _ -> eval_apply (eval_list env args) func
(* Macros are the same, they just return code that *will* be evaluated
in the calling environment *)
| LUnnamedMacro _
| LMacro _ -> eval_one env (eval_apply args func)
| v -> raise (Invalid_argument
(Printf.sprintf "eval_apply: cannot call non-function object %s" (dbg_print_one v)))
and (* This only creates a *local* binding, contained to the body given. *)
bind_local env =
function
| LCons (LSymbol s, LCons (v, body)) ->
let e = env_new_lexical env in
env_set_local e s v;
eval_body e body
| _ -> invalid_arg "invalid argument to bind-local"
and lisp_if env = function
| LCons (cond, LCons (if_true, LNil)) ->
(match eval_one env cond with
| LNil -> LNil
| _ -> eval_one env if_true)
| LCons (cond, LCons (if_true, LCons (if_false, LNil))) ->
(match eval_one env cond with
| LNil -> eval_one env if_false
| _ -> eval_one env if_true)
| _ -> invalid_arg "invalid argument list passed to if!"
let eval_all env vs =
let ev v = eval_one env v in
List.map ev vs
let () = add_builtin "+" add
let () = add_builtin "-" sub
let () = add_builtin "car" car
let () = add_builtin "cdr" cdr
let () = add_builtin "cons" cons
let () = add_builtin "bind-symbol" bind_symbol
let () = add_builtin "list" lisp_list
let () = add_special "fn" lambda
let () = add_special "fn-macro" lambda_macro
let () = add_special "let-one" bind_local
let () = add_special "quote" (fun _ -> function
| LCons (x, LNil) -> x
| _ -> invalid_arg "hmm")
let () = add_special "if" lisp_if
